India Olive Oil Market Overview:

Olive oil is the liquid fat derivative obtained from olives, which is a traditional tree crop of the Mediterranean Basin. It is native to the Mediterranean regions and is especially found in Spain, Italy, and Greece. The composition of olive oil varies with altitude, time of harvest, and extraction process. It has a low smoke point of 240°C and hence can be consumed raw. This oil is primarily used for cooking, cosmetics, and pharmaceutical applications. It mainly consists of oleic acid, with the smaller amount of fatty acids including linoleic acid (up to 21%) and palmitic acid (up to 20%). Olive oil consumption is often considered healthy as it is associated with a lower risk of heart disease and certain cancers including colorectal and breast cancer. It is also a good source of monounsaturated fatty acid and antioxidants such as polyphenols, vitamins E & K, chlorophyll, and carotenoids. The nutritional value and taste associated with olive oil have raised its demand among the consumers. It has a wide range of application in the food and cosmetics industries.

In addition, the health benefits associated with olive oil are expected to increase the demand for India olive oil market in the coming years. Virgin olive oil segment has dominated the market due to its chemical free processing techniques and dense nutritional content. Furthermore, growing acceptance of olive oil in culinary uses is expected to increase the demand for the olive oil market in food and beverage applications. Moreover, personal care products are blended with olive oil extracts and have gained market acceptance due to the skin benefits associated with it. Increase in purchasing power and rise in aspiration among the lower- and middle-class society in the nation and industry players coming out with products and pricing to suit consumes across different levels of purchasing power drive the growth of the India olive oil market for personal care. However, limited production of olives in India coupled with fluctuations in olive oil prices have hindered the market growth but increase in demand for olive oil for cooking is expected to provide lucrative opportunities for the growth of the India olive oil market.

Executive Summary

According to a new report titled, 'India Olive Oil Market by Type and Application: Opportunity Analysis and Industry Forecast, 2018 - 2025,' the India olive oil market was worth 58.6 million in 2017 and is estimated to be growing at a CAGR of 9.9%, to reach 127.5 million by 2025. Olive oil is a liquid fat that is obtained from olives, a crop typically grown in the Mediterranean Basin. The oil is prepared by pressing whole olives. There are various types of olives such as Picholine, Kalamata, Agrinion olives, Cerignola, and many others, each type is for a particular texture, flavor, or shelf life, which can be used for various applications. By type, the India olive oil market is classified into virgin olive oil, refined olive oil, and pomace olive oil. In 2017, virgin olive oil segment has occupied 15.1% share of the India olive oil market due to its improved nutritional content. Furthermore, the growing acceptance of olive oil in culinary uses is likely to increase its market demand for food and beverage applications.

The factors that drive the India olive oil market include rise in demand for olive oil continuously from end-user industries, growth in awareness about the various health benefits offered by the oil, increase in usage in the manufacturing of products in the beauty care and cosmetics industry, beverages industry, and pharmaceutical industry among others. Changing lifestyle is also anticipated to drive the India olive oil market growth.

However, higher prices of olive oils and poor domestic production restrict the growth of the olive oil market in India. Nevertheless, government is taking initiative to promote efficient farming techniques developed by the market players, which are effectively increasing the production of olives. These initiatives are estimated to provide impetus to the India olive oil market growth during the forecast period.

Key Findings of the India Olive Oil Market:

The personal care segment was the highest contributor to the India olive oil market in 2017, and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 9.0%.
In 2017, virgin olive oil segment accounted for 15.1% of the India olive oil market and is projected to grow at the most astounding CAGR of 14.5% from 2018 to 2025.
In 2017, pomace olive oil accounted for almost 65.7% of the share in terms of value in the India olive oil market and is projected to grow at a significant CAGR of 9.1%.
Pharmaceutical accounted for the 24.5% market share with CAGR of 9.6% in the India olive oil market, in 2017.
In 2017, the food segment accounted for 20.0% of the India olive oil market share and is expected to grow at the significant CAGR of 12.7%.
